In the movie Hot Tub Time Machine, a group of lifelong friends, Adam, Lou, and Nick, along with Adam's nephew Jacob, decide to take a nostalgic trip to a ski resort, Kodiak Valley, where they had the time of their lives in their youth. However, their getaway takes an unexpected turn when they discover a mysterious, malfunctioning hot tub that somehow becomes a time machine.

While soaking in the tub, the group is transported back in time to the year 1986, finding themselves in their own younger bodies.
